Recently, a small advocacy group in Nebraska published an op-ed promoting what is commonly known as “Right to Repair” legislation. The group argued that Right to Repair will lead to increased competition and decreased prices for consumers. What these proponents didn’t tell you is that this type of legislation does little to protect consumers and instead jeopardizes both safety and environmental protections in several ways.

In Little League, coaches tell young players to “keep your eye on the ball.” The advice applies to both fielding and batting, but it is just as applicable to running a successful farm equipment dealership. That’s just what Don Van Houweling, owner of the 2016 Dealership of the Year, has done at Van Wall Equipment.
Despite the downturn in the ag economy, the independent judging panel once again had an impressive pool of candidates to choose in naming as this year’s Dealership of the Year recipient. Commenting on the pool of nominees the judges say, “We feel all nominees have done a very good job in profitability in view of the ‘down’ year in agriculture.”
